[Bug 4209] New: mono 1.2.6 fails to build

bugzilla-daemon at amethyst.openembedded.net bugzilla-daemon at amethyst.openembedded.net
Thu May 1 10:28:49 UTC 2008


http://bugs.openembedded.net/show_bug.cgi?id=4209

           Summary: mono 1.2.6 fails to build                              
    Classification: Unclassified                                           
           Product: Openembedded                                           
           Version: Angstrom unstable                                      
          Platform: Other                                                  
        OS/Version: other                                                  
            Status: UNCONFIRMED                                            
          Severity: minor                                                  
          Priority: P3                                                     
         Component: Build                                                  
        AssignedTo: openembedded-issues at lists.openembedded.org             
        ReportedBy: cliff.brake at gmail.com                                  


machine: cm-x270
host: AMD64
2008-04-30 OE dev snapshot

include -I../../libgc/include -DMONO_BINDIR=\"/usr/bin\" -I../..
-isystem/build/rep3/oe/build/angstrom-2008.1/tmp/staging/arm-angstrom-linux-gnueabi/usr/include
-DGC_LINUX_THREADS -D_GNU_SOURCE -D_REENTRANT -DUSE_MMAP -DUSE_MUNMAP
-DARM_FPU_NONE=1 -DNO_UNALIGNED_ACCESS
-isystem/build/rep3/oe/build/angstrom-2008.1/tmp/staging/arm-angstrom-linux-gnueabi/usr/include
-fexpensive-optimizations -frename-registers -fomit-frame-pointer -Os
-fno-strict-aliasing -Wdeclaration-after-statement -g -Wall -Wunused
-Wmissing-prototypes -Wmissing-declarations -Wstrict-prototypes
-Wmissing-prototypes -Wnested-externs -Wpointer-arith -Wno-cast-qual
-Wcast-align -Wwrite-strings -MT wapi_glob.lo -MD -MP -MF .deps/wapi_glob.Tpo
-c wapi_glob.c -o wapi_glob.o >/dev/null 2>&1
| /bin/sh ../../arm-angstrom-linux-gnueabi-libtool --tag=CC --mode=link
arm-angstrom-linux-gnueabi-gcc -march=armv5te -mtune=xscale 
-isystem/build/rep3/oe/build/angstrom-2008.1/tmp/staging/arm-angstrom-linux-gnueabi/usr/include
-fexpensive-optimizations -frename-registers -fomit-frame-pointer -Os
-fno-strict-aliasing -Wdeclaration-after-statement -g -Wall -Wunused
-Wmissing-prototypes -Wmissing-declarations -Wstrict-prototypes 
-Wmissing-prototypes -Wnested-externs -Wpointer-arith -Wno-cast-qual
-Wcast-align -Wwrite-strings 
-L/build/rep3/oe/build/angstrom-2008.1/tmp/staging/arm-angstrom-linux-gnueabi/usr/lib
-Wl,-rpath-link,/build/rep3/oe/build/angstrom-2008.1/tmp/staging/arm-angstrom-linux-gnueabi/usr/lib
-Wl,-O1 -o libwapi.la   atomic.lo collection.lo context.lo critical-sections.lo
error.lo events.lo handles.lo io.lo io-portability.lo misc.lo mutexes.lo
mono-mutex.lo processes.lo security.lo semaphores.lo shared.lo sockets.lo
system.lo threads.lo timefuncs.lo wait.lo wapi_glob.lo  -ldl -lpthread -lm
| arm-angstrom-linux-gnueabi-ar cru .libs/libwapi.a .libs/atomic.o
.libs/collection.o .libs/context.o .libs/critical-sections.o .libs/error.o
.libs/events.o .libs/handles.o .libs/io.o .libs/io-portability.o .libs/misc.o
.libs/mutexes.o .libs/mono-mutex.o .libs/processes.o .libs/security.o
.libs/semaphores.o .libs/shared.o .libs/sockets.o .libs/system.o
.libs/threads.o .libs/timefuncs.o .libs/wait.o .libs/wapi_glob.o
| arm-angstrom-linux-gnueabi-ranlib .libs/libwapi.a
| creating libwapi.la
| (cd .libs && rm -f libwapi.la && ln -s ../libwapi.la libwapi.la)
| make[3]: Leaving directory
`/build/rep3/oe/build/angstrom-2008.1/tmp/work/armv5te-angstrom-linux-gnueabi/mono-1.2.6-r1/mono-1.2.6/mono/io-layer'
| Making all in monoburg
| make[3]: Entering directory
`/build/rep3/oe/build/angstrom-2008.1/tmp/work/armv5te-angstrom-linux-gnueabi/mono-1.2.6-r1/mono-1.2.6/mono/monoburg'
| bison ./monoburg.y -o parser.c
| cc -o monoburg ./monoburg.c parser.c -pthread
-I/build/rep3/oe/build/angstrom-2008.1/tmp/staging/arm-angstrom-linux-gnueabi/usr/include/glib-2.0
-I/build/rep3/oe/build/angstrom-2008.1/tmp/staging/arm-angstrom-linux-gnueabi/usr/lib/glib-2.0/include
  -I. -I../.. 
-L/build/rep3/oe/build/angstrom-2008.1/tmp/staging/arm-angstrom-linux-gnueabi/usr/lib
-Wl,-rpath-link,/build/rep3/oe/build/angstrom-2008.1/tmp/staging/arm-angstrom-linux-gnueabi/usr/lib
-Wl,-O1 -pthread -lgthread-2.0 -lrt -lglib-2.0
| ./monoburg.c: In function 'create_term':
| ./monoburg.c:164: warning: cast to pointer from integer of different size
| ./monoburg.c: In function 'emit_emitter_func':
| ./monoburg.c:717: warning: cast to pointer from integer of different size
| ./monoburg.c:719: warning: cast to pointer from integer of different size
| ./monoburg.c:734: warning: cast from pointer to integer of different size
| ./monoburg.c:740: warning: cast from pointer to integer of different size
| /usr/bin/ld: skipping incompatible
/build/rep3/oe/build/angstrom-2008.1/tmp/staging/arm-angstrom-linux-gnueabi/usr/lib/libgthread-2.0.so
when searching for -lgthread-2.0
| /usr/bin/ld: skipping incompatible
/build/rep3/oe/build/angstrom-2008.1/tmp/staging/arm-angstrom-linux-gnueabi/usr/lib/librt.so
when searching for -lrt
| /usr/bin/ld: skipping incompatible
/build/rep3/oe/build/angstrom-2008.1/tmp/staging/arm-angstrom-linux-gnueabi/usr/lib/librt.a
when searching for -lrt
| /usr/bin/ld: skipping incompatible
/build/rep3/oe/build/angstrom-2008.1/tmp/staging/arm-angstrom-linux-gnueabi/usr/lib/libglib-2.0.so
when searching for -lglib-2.0
| /usr/bin/ld: skipping incompatible
/build/rep3/oe/build/angstrom-2008.1/tmp/staging/arm-angstrom-linux-gnueabi/usr/lib/libpthread.so
when searching for -lpthread
| /usr/bin/ld: skipping incompatible
/build/rep3/oe/build/angstrom-2008.1/tmp/staging/arm-angstrom-linux-gnueabi/usr/lib/libpthread.a
when searching for -lpthread
| /tmp/ccYvEERe.o: In function `emit_state':
| monoburg.c:(.text+0xbbe): undefined reference to `g_assertion_message_expr'
| collect2: ld returned 1 exit status
| make[3]: *** [monoburg] Error 1
| make[3]: Leaving directory
`/build/rep3/oe/build/angstrom-2008.1/tmp/work/armv5te-angstrom-linux-gnueabi/mono-1.2.6-r1/mono-1.2.6/mono/monoburg'
| make[2]: *** [all-recursive] Error 1
| make[2]: Leaving directory
`/build/rep3/oe/build/angstrom-2008.1/tmp/work/armv5te-angstrom-linux-gnueabi/mono-1.2.6-r1/mono-1.2.6/mono'
| make[1]: *** [all-recursive] Error 1
| make[1]: Leaving directory
`/build/rep3/oe/build/angstrom-2008.1/tmp/work/armv5te-angstrom-linux-gnueabi/mono-1.2.6-r1/mono-1.2.6'
| make: *** [all] Error 2
| FATAL: oe_runmake failed
NOTE: Task failed:
/build/rep3/oe/build/angstrom-2008.1/tmp/work/armv5te-angstrom-linux-gnueabi/mono-1.2.6-r1/temp/log.do_compile.17689
NOTE: package mono-1.2.6-r1: task do_compile: failed
ERROR: TaskFailed event exception, aborting
NOTE: package mono-1.2.6: failed
ERROR: Build of
/build/rep3/oe/oe/org.openembedded.dev/packages/mono/mono_1.2.6.bb do_compile
failed
ERROR: Task 162
(/build/rep3/oe/oe/org.openembedded.dev/packages/mono/mono_1.2.6.bb,
do_compile) failed
NOTE: Tasks Summary: Attempted 1188 tasks of which 0 didn't need to be rerun
and 1 failed.
ERROR: '/build/rep3/oe/oe/org.openembedded.dev/packages/mono/mono_1.2.6.bb'
failed

-- 
Configure bugmail: http://bugs.openembedded.net/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the assignee for the bug.




More information about the Openembedded-issues mailing list